Valcom V-9010-W Vandal-Resistant Ceiling Speaker

Overview

The Valcom V-9010-W is a self-amplified, vandal-resistant ceiling speaker built for paging and emergency-tone deployments in spaces where equipment takes abuse — detention areas, stairwells, locker rooms, parking structures, and any concrete-ceiling environment where a standard drop-in speaker would not survive. Instead of a typical thin-gauge grille, the V-9010-W uses an 18-gauge steel housing with a smooth, tapered exterior that gives vandals nothing to grab or pry, backed by a 24-gauge steel security screen and tamper-resistant screws. It is a surface-mount design, not a lay-in ceiling tile speaker, which matters when you are speccing hardened spaces where drop ceilings are not an option.

Key Features

  • 18-gauge steel housing with tapered profile: the smooth exterior prevents grasping or leverage, which is the actual failure mode vandal-resistant speakers are designed against — not just impact resistance, but resistance to someone trying to rip the unit off the wall or ceiling.
  • 24-gauge steel security screen + tamper-resistant screws: stops sharp objects from being pushed through the speaker cone, a common vandalism and safety issue in detention or public-access spaces where standard grille cloth or plastic would fail immediately.
  • Self-amplified, 1-watt output: the V-9010-W carries its own amplifier module, so you are not dependent on a separate zone amp for basic paging coverage — simplifies wiring in retrofit jobs where pulling new amplifier runs is not practical.
  • 95 dB @ 4ft output rating: loud enough to cut through ambient noise in mechanical rooms, gyms, or parking garages where paging and emergency tones need to be intelligible over background noise.
  • 200 Hz–8 kHz frequency response: tuned for voice paging and tone clarity rather than music reproduction — appropriate for the emergency-alert and announcement use case this speaker is built for.
  • -24 Vdc power at 50 mA: low current draw keeps a single paging power supply able to run multiple zones without oversizing the supply, a real consideration when budgeting a multi-speaker paging system.
  • Wide operating range, -4°F to +131°F (-20°C to +55°C): holds up in unconditioned mechanical spaces, parking structures, and other environments outside normal HVAC comfort range.
  • 0–95% non-condensing humidity tolerance: covers garages, loading docks, and other semi-exposed indoor spaces with humidity swings, without the added cost of a fully outdoor-rated enclosure.
  • Dual mounting: standard 4-inch electrical box, wall, or ceiling: mounts to a standard 4-inch square or octagon electrical box, or fastens directly to wall or ceiling surface — gives installers flexibility on retrofit jobs where box placement varies.
  • White epoxy powder coat finish: baked-on urethane finish matches typical institutional ceiling and wall colors without requiring field painting.

Integration & Compatibility

The V-9010-W is built as a standalone paging endpoint — speaker, amplifier module, volume control, and housing are matched as one electrically and acoustically tested assembly, not a field-paired speaker-and-amp kit. Input is -10 dBm line level at greater than 600 Ohms nominal impedance, which is standard for paging system head-ends and zone controllers. This model, V-9010-W (often searched as V 9010 W), is rated for indoor applications only — for exterior mounting under a soffit or canopy, confirm environmental exposure against the -4°F to +131°F operating range before specifying it outdoors. If your project needs two-way audio at the speaker location rather than one-way paging, this model will not cover that use case since it is a one-way amplified design.

Frequently Asked Questions

Q: Is the V-9010-W rated for outdoor use?

A: No. The V-9010-W is specified for indoor applications, with an operating temperature range of -4°F to +131°F (-20°C to +55°C) and 0-95% non-condensing humidity.

Q: Can the V-9010-W be ceiling-mounted or is it wall-only?

A: Both. It mounts to a standard 4-inch square or octagon electrical box, or can be fastened directly to a wall or ceiling surface.

Q: What power supply does the V-9010-W require?

A: It runs on -24 Vdc nominal at 50 mA, with a signal input of -10 dBm line level at greater than 600 Ohms nominal impedance.

Q: How loud is the V-9010-W?

A: It is rated at greater than 95 dB measured at 4 feet, with a 1-watt self-amplified output.

Q: What's the warranty on the V-9010-W?

A: The V-9010-W carries a 3-year warranty.

Q: How does the V-9010-W resist vandalism?

A: It uses an 18-gauge steel housing with a smooth, tapered exterior that resists grasping, plus a 24-gauge steel security screen and tamper-resistant screws to prevent objects from penetrating the speaker.

The detail that gets overlooked on vandal-resistant speakers is the shape, not just the gauge of steel. The V-9010-W's tapered exterior is the actual defense mechanism — there's nothing to hook fingers or a tool under, which matters more in practice than raw housing thickness.

Technical Highlights:

  • 18-gauge steel housing, 24-gauge security screen: the housing takes the impact load while the lighter-gauge internal screen stops probing or penetration without adding significant weight — total unit weight is a manageable 4.80 lbs.
  • 50 mA @ -24 Vdc power draw: low enough that a paging system power supply can run a meaningful number of these zones without needing a supply upgrade — worth checking against your existing paging head-end capacity before adding V-9010-W units to a run.
  • 200 Hz–8 kHz response at >95 dB @ 4ft: this is a voice-and-tone speaker, not a music speaker — the bandwidth is intentionally narrow for paging intelligibility, which is the right tradeoff for the application.

Deployment Considerations:

  • It mounts to a standard 4-inch square or octagon electrical box or direct-fastens to wall or ceiling — on concrete ceiling retrofits, direct-fasten avoids needing to set a box, which is often the harder part of the job.
  • It's an indoor-rated unit (-4°F to +131°F, non-condensing humidity only) — don't spec it for exposed exterior mounting; if the location gets weather exposure, that's outside what this housing is rated for.

This is the right call for a detention corridor or parking structure stairwell paging zone where past speakers have been ripped off the wall or had objects jammed into the cone — the V-9010-W's tapered housing and security screen are built specifically for that failure pattern, not general-purpose office paging.
